Hi everyone,

I haven't been on often and it's been 8-9 months since I got her. Didn't think my post would be popular enough to be pinned. I still have her and her quality is excellent. Nothing has fallen apart or is loose or anything so far. The new silicone odor has dissipated greatly so it's no longer a big problem. Quality wise I don't have any issues, it's quite well built.

I have found new dark clothing even after washing several times to stain her on spots that pressure the cloth against her skin. Rest assured the stain will go away after a few weeks since Silicone repels the dyes no matter how bad the stain. Don't apply alcohol or cleanser to force it to go away. I just let it sit and breathe air and after a while give a rinse with water in the bath. It will go away.

I want to talk a bit about the clothing fit since it's something I have been working on over the months. I think clothing size is very important since I have had issues and have had to waste some money to get the right fit. Baggy clothes don't look good.

For underwear, I find Victoria's Secret to be great and the fabric quality is better than the super cheap stores. I initially tried Yandy for cheap underwear and they feel like plastic, not comfortable and very brittle. For bras and underwear I just get the smallest size from Victoria's Secret which is XS. The store also uses more customized measurement for Bras like 30D but I have found XS to work just fine so I stuck with that. Worst comes to shove you can wash and dryer the clothing to shrink it a bit.

I find Yandy good for stockings/socks. They're cheap and they're comfortable. Again I get the smallest size XS or One Size Fits All (since sometimes the socks have no size since they're stretchy).

For shoes I have not had luck with Size 5 womens US. It was too long. I will try Size 4 next time and the only place I can find sizes that small are on Ebay.

For clothing I use Forever21, the pricing is affordable and you won't need the most highest quality wear since your doll isn't walking outside and using the clothing everyday. I have found dresses of size XS to work, and that's the most I've had success with so far. Some skirts with XS were too long from what was pictured since the doll isn't tall as your average American woman. I have found XS tops to work fine but some may be too small or tight because her bust size is large. For pants/shorts/jeans I haven't ventured into that space yet, I would imagine a XS shorts that has stretchable waist to be the easiest to get fit.

I have purchased a sewing machine and will be learning to tailoring my clothing in the future.
